Understanding the basics of coating durability

Exterior paint serves as much more than a decorative layer. It acts as a sacrificial barrier that protects the underlying substrate, such as wood, stucco, or fiber cement, from environmental degradation. When this barrier fails, the structural integrity of your siding can be compromised by moisture infiltration.

Environmental factors influencing paint longevity

The climate surrounding your property plays a massive role in how quickly coatings degrade. A house located in a high UV index area will experience much faster pigment fading than one in a temperate zone.

Ultraviolet rays break down the chemical bonds in paint resins. This process leads to chalking, where a fine powder forms on the surface, and eventually results in significant color loss.

High humidity and frequent rain cycles can trap moisture behind the paint film. If you notice any signs that you must fix water stains on your siding, it may indicate that the coating has already lost its waterproof properties.

Identifying critical failure points

Recognizing the early stages of coating failure can save you from much larger expenses. Homeowners should regularly inspect their siding for specific visible house repainting signs to prevent rot.

  • Peeling or flaking paint that exposes the raw substrate.
  • Fine cracks in the coating that allow water to seep in.
  • Blistering caused by trapped moisture or heat.
  • Chalking, which is the appearance of a powdery residue on the surface.
  • Fading or uneven coloration across different sides of the house.

The consequences of delayed maintenance

Ignoring a failing paint job is a risk that can lead to structural decay. Once moisture penetrates the wood or siding, it can trigger fungal growth and wood rot, which are significantly more expensive to address than a simple repaint.

How to extend your coating life

While you cannot control the weather, you can take steps to improve the resilience of your home's exterior. A professional specialist will often recommend a rigorous preparation process to ensure the new layer adheres properly.

  • Regularly cleaning siding to remove dirt, salt, and organic growth.
  • Ensuring gutters and downspouts direct water away from the walls.
  • Using high quality primers designed for the specific substrate.
  • Addressing small cracks immediately before they expand.
